What is Digital Marketing? Uses of Digital Marketing

  1. What is Digital Marketing?

Digital marketing is the practice of promoting products, services, or brands through digital platforms and online technologies. It utilizes the internet, mobile devices, social media, search engines, and other digital channels to connect businesses with their target audiences. Unlike traditional marketing, which relies on print media, television, or billboards, digital marketing allows for interactive engagement, measurable outcomes, and global reach.

In the modern era, where consumers spend a large portion of their time online, digital marketing has become a vital part of every business strategy. It helps organizations build awareness, attract potential customers, and foster lasting relationships—all through online communication and personalized experiences.

  1. Uses 

Digital marketing serves several purposes that benefit businesses of all sizes and industries. Below are some of its major uses:

a. Building Brand Awareness

One of the primary uses of digital marketing is to enhance a brand’s visibility. With billions of people using the internet daily, businesses can use online platforms such as social media, websites, and search engines to increase their exposure. Consistent online presence helps create brand recognition and trust among consumers.

b. Generating Leads and Sales

Digital marketing plays a crucial role in generating qualified leads and driving sales. Strategies like Search Engine Optimization (SEO), Pay-Per-Click (PPC) advertising, and social media marketing help attract potential customers to a business website. Once visitors engage with the content, they can be converted into leads or customers through targeted offers, landing pages, and email campaigns.

c. Cost-Effective Promotion

Compared to traditional marketing methods such as print or television advertising, digital marketing is far more affordable. Businesses can start small and scale their campaigns based on performance. This makes it ideal for startups and small enterprises that want to reach large audiences without spending excessively.

d. Targeted Advertising

Digital marketing allows businesses to reach specific groups of people based on age, gender, location, interests, and behavior. For example, a fashion brand can display its ads only to users interested in clothing and accessories. This level of targeting ensures that marketing efforts are focused on audiences most likely to make a purchase.

e. Enhancing Customer Engagement

Through social media platforms like Instagram, Facebook, and X (formerly Twitter), businesses can directly interact with their customers. Replying to comments, responding to feedback, and sharing engaging content help create stronger relationships with audiences. This constant engagement also encourages customer loyalty and trust.

f. Global Reach

Digital marketing breaks geographical barriers, allowing businesses to reach audiences across the world. A company based in one country can easily sell its products or services internationally through online marketing strategies. This global exposure opens up new opportunities for growth and expansion.

g. Real-Time Performance Tracking

One of the most important uses of digital marketing is its ability to measure performance instantly. Businesses can track key metrics such as website traffic, click-through rates, and conversion rates through tools like Google Analytics. This helps marketers understand what works and what needs improvement, ensuring better results in future campaigns.

h. Personalized Marketing

With the help of data analytics, enables businesses to deliver personalized experiences. For instance, customers can receive tailored product recommendations, personalized emails, or targeted advertisements based on their previous behavior. Personalization increases customer satisfaction and improves conversion rates.
